Depends on how you drive. You can get up to 30% max discount, but depends on how you drive (hard brakes, fast accel, late night driving, amount of driving time). It can hurt your rate if you constantly slam bakes or floor the gas pedal, but as long as you drive fairly normal it should help you.

ETA: I ended up with 15% credit
